Bosche or Br\u00fcgel.<\/p>\n<figure id=\"attachment_12007\" aria-describedby=\"caption-attachment-12007\" style=\"width: 750px\" class=\"wp-caption alignnone\"><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" class=\"wp-image-12007\" src=\"https:\/\/static-edge.kiaf.org\/web\/2022\/01\/19001629\/%EA%B9%80%EB%AA%85%EC%A7%84-Edgewalker-oil-pastel-acrylic-on-canavs-2020-116.8X91cm-2-1.jpg\" alt=\"\" width=\"750\" height=\"963\" srcset=\"https:\/\/static-edge.kiaf.org\/web\/2022\/01\/19001629\/%EA%B9%80%EB%AA%85%EC%A7%84-Edgewalker-oil-pastel-acrylic-on-canavs-2020-116.8X91cm-2-1.jpg 623w, https:\/\/static-edge.kiaf.org\/web\/2022\/01\/19001629\/%EA%B9%80%EB%AA%85%EC%A7%84-Edgewalker-oil-pastel-acrylic-on-canavs-2020-116.8X91cm-2-1-234x300.jpg 234w, https:\/\/static-edge.kiaf.org\/web\/2022\/01\/19001629\/%EA%B9%80%EB%AA%85%EC%A7%84-Edgewalker-oil-pastel-acrylic-on-canavs-2020-116.8X91cm-2-1-117x150.jpg 117w\" sizes=\"auto, (max-width: 750px) 100vw, 750px\" \/><figcaption id=\"caption-attachment-12007\" class=\"wp-caption-text\">Kim Myoung-Jin, Edgewalker, oil pastel &amp; acrylic on canavs, 2020 116.8X91cm<\/figcaption><\/figure>\n<p>The act of painting is to coat a canvas with paints. To coat a canvas, first you have to be aware of the canvas. Some artists cover the space and paint a new phantom of space on top of it, and some show the original canvas to emphasize the mixed use of material of the canvas and the paints. This method is known as \u2018unfinished\u2019, \u2018descriptive attitude\u2019, or \u2018similar to the drawing\u2019, but there is more fundamental atmospherics here. This atmospherics has been handled as focal value through out the consistent genealogy of oil painting from A. Gorky to C. Twombly with abstract expressionists along the way. It is the physical and transcendental combined weaves fabricated by the light emitting from the white color of the canvas and paints smeared on the canvas with a brush. In this case, the artist smears paints by controlling the light from the white background, rather than covering the canvas with paints. It is the same in Kim\u2019s case; his canvas is full of bright background. In his canvas, there is energy from the brush and paints fighting with the canvas, and sliding and scattered in the canvas, as if life scenes that is close to a play, and shouting and noise of streets in the city are bustling in the broad day light. <br \/>\nThe artist himself appears often in this implied space.
